- The distance between Sault Ste. Marie, Mi, Usa and Lisbon, Portugal is approximately 5,984 km or 3,718 mi.
- To reach Sault Ste. Marie, Mi in this distance one would set out from Lisbon bearing 304.4°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Sault Ste. Marie, Mi bearing 249.2° or WSW .
- Sault Ste. Marie, Mi has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Lisbon has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Sault Ste. Marie, Mi is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Lisbon is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The average temperature is 12.5 °C (22.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.9 °C (30.4°F) more in Sault Ste. Marie, Mi.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 116.4 mm (4.6 in) more which is equivalent to 116.4 l/m² (2.86 US gal/ft²) or 1,164,000 l/ha (124,439 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.8° lower in Sault Ste. Marie, Mi than in Lisbon.
